As I am, according to you, that "random bloke on BHQ" who raised yet again the question of Bennett and Boyd's contract a few posts ago, my point was to situate my thoughts in the context of an issue often debated on here recently, and rightly so - the Broncos culture, something Kevvie has to deal with now and is doing so, roster wise at least, and my view that a lot of it has to do with Bennett's profound influence on that culture, particularly in recruitment and retention. I am not so much trying to blame Bennett as highlight his influence on the club, particularly since 2017, and how that played out particularly given his sacking, its circumstances, and what happened to us this year. That is why I raised my point in this thread. As I see it, it's a big deal for Kevvie. Part of his unenviable job is start a Walters culture, displacing and in part, dispersing Bennett's influence on the club (but separate and distinct from Wayne's justly hallowed place in Broncos history. His reputation as a great coach is not in question.) So I used the Boyd contract issue as just one example of Bennett's serious influence on the Broncos, and, at the back of mind, I still think about the group of Bennett acolytes, who I have also mentioned, and do so again in this regard - Milford, Lodge, Oates, Pangai and Offa, all key, senior players and all who both screwed up on field in 2020, and also for mine, were part of the putsch to eliminate Seibold, as I see it, to avenge Bennett's sacking, through shit performances, and also, through white anting Seibold privately, publicly (TPJ) and in the media. Disloyalty to their coach is a word that comes to mind, and of course, their actions had a terrible effect on the club and on us, loyal fans. Again, I am not blaming Bennett for those players having their own personal agendas as I allege, but I am ascribing those to Bennett's profound influence on the players who adore him. So I am sure Walters wants none of that under his watch, and I am guessing he wants some accountability from those players for their actions in 2020, and to ensure he has their 100% loyalty and performance guarantees for the next 2 years at least, so he can be remembered as a great coach in his own right, and not as a footnote to Bennett. Maybe I am drawing a long bow, but it is how I feel, and when I remember this season, I feel like shit. So yes, bring on the Kevolution ASAP. [/QUOTE]
